Output 75e25b39c8bdcb0f5176e383baae55430e10d8c09866a14874fc73a24a01572e:0

value
2682539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f1a39075a4f619e1eaf1c291472ed4b1a9d6b06 OP_EQUAL
address
3GCGn2xvroXY7yrebnsx3vho6o3is21oNS
transaction
75e25b39c8bdcb0f5176e383baae55430e10d8c09866a14874fc73a24a01572e
spent
true